San Mateo, CA, January 31, 2014 – California-based family-friendly app developer Selectsoft is pleased to announce the release of Magical Monograms, a new wallpaper and icon skin app for iPhone and iPad. Personalization is a hot trend for phones and tablets, and Magical Monograms makes it easy for users to add a custom touch to their lock and home screens with fun and unique designer-created monogrammed wallpapers.
With Magical Monograms, users can quickly create stylish lock and home screen monogram combos with single initials, names and triple initials. When creating a new monogram, users start by typing in their first name and middle and last initials. They can then quickly swipe through multiple designs to preview a variety of font and background combinations, with each lock screen pattern also accompanied by a matching monogrammed home screen. Users pick their perfect designs, save to the camera roll and then can choose which combo to use to customize their device. The easy-to-use interface makes it simple to create wallpapers to suit any mood, plus users can even make designs for friends and family to share via email, Twitter, Facebook and the camera roll.
The original, exclusive backgrounds are artist-designed and created, ranging from traditional „preppy“ designs to creative photo backgrounds, and featuring eye-catching patterns, textures, animals and more paired with matching fonts. The app contains over 60 design combinations to personalize and an additional 30+ designs to unlock.
